You're absolutely right... the shorter tires dramatically increase
effective gearing (like going from a 3.27 to a 3.89 diff) and lower the
car. Depending on your point of view, those may be advantages or
disadvantages. But the 205/60-13s are a practical alternative and I've
run them on a number of Corvairs. A bonus is that the tires are usually
performance oriented and really improve handling over economy tuned
tires. Love them around town; on the interstate not so much. ;-).
